Job title: Senior Software Engineer
Job type: Permanent
Emp type: Full-time
Location: Sydney, NSW
Job published: 03-12-2025
Job ID: 55489

Job Description

Senior Full Stack Engineer (Backend Focus - Java)

🏠 Hybrid – 50/50 split

đź’°Up to $170K+Super

We’re looking for a senior engineer who’s strongest on the backend but happy to dip into full stack when needed. You’ll split your time between our customer engineering team and our platform team-jumping in where you can have the most impact.

This is the hiring manager’s first role in this space, so it’s a big one. You’ll have the chance to set the tone for how we build, raise the bar on quality, and help shape the team culture as we grow.

Day-to-day, you’ll be working on a Java-based SaaS platform that powers multiple customer products. You’ll get stuck into building new features, fixing tricky performance issues, and making smart architecture decisions. If you’re interested, there’s a clear path here to Team Lead or Principal Engineer- but you can stay deep in the tech if that’s your thing.

Why you might like this role

  • You’ll work across both customer and platform engineering, so you’ll always have interesting problems to solve.

  • You’ll get to bring fresh ideas on how we build software and make them happen.

  • You’ll work closely with other senior engineers, team leads, and product folks who actually value your input.

What you’ll be doing

  • Taking ownership of projects from the idea stage right through to delivery and improvement.

  • Building, refactoring, and tuning systems in Java, Docker, Postgres (and sometimes React).

  • Figuring out whether something’s a platform problem or a product bug - and fixing it the right way.

  • Helping other engineers level up through mentoring and knowledge sharing.

What we’re looking for

  • Strong experience with Java-based SaaS platforms and backend work.

  • Solid architecture skills and the ability to spot problems before they blow up.

  • A track record of shipping real, complex projects.

  • Someone who naturally steps up to guide others and improve the way the team works.

đź“§ Sound like a fit? Send your CV to Monica@theonset.com.au or Girlie@theonset.com.au